What is a Mail Survey?

A mail survey is a type of survey that is conducted by sending out a questionnaire to a large group of people through the mail. This method is often used for marketing research or customer satisfaction surveys.  A company may use this method if they want to find out how happy their customers are with their product and services, or how satisfied they are with what they have purchased. This way, the company can see where there are opportunities for improvement and make changes in order to make customers happier with their purchase. The company will also be able to see if it needs more products or different types of products in order to suit the needs of its customers better.  If you plan on using a mail survey, make sure you design your questionnaire well so that the information you get back from those who answer is easy to read and understand. Applicability of Mail Surveys

Mail surveys are useful when you need to reach people who are not easily accessible, such as those who live in remote areas or who do not have regular access to the internet.
